Keeping control of your media in your hands
13 avril 2011, parThe vocabulary used on this site and around MediaSPIP in general, aims to avoid reference to Web 2.0 and the companies that profit from media-sharing.
While using MediaSPIP, you are invited to avoid using words like "Brand", "Cloud" and "Market".
MediaSPIP is designed to facilitate the sharing of creative media online, while allowing authors to retain complete control of their work.

Android MediaMetadataRetriever.METADATA_KEY_DATE gives only date of video on galaxy S7
15 mai 2023, par Zaid Bin TariqI am writing a code to get video creation date and time from metadata, i am using following code to get creation date



MediaMetadataRetriever retriever = new MediaMetadataRetriever();
retriever.setDataSource(path_to_video);
String date = retriever.extractMetadata(MediaMetadataRetriever.METADATA_KEY_DATE);




it works perfect on all devices except Samsung Galaxy S7, it returns only date in "YYYY MM DD" format, no time stamp i need both date and timestamp.



any help in this regard is much appreciated.

Create H.264 stream from single PNG
28 avril 2017, par Jim RhodesI have an application that uses RTSP to get a video stream from an IP camera. The application extracts the H.264 data from the RTP packets and sends it to a remote process that decodes the stream (using ffmpeg) and displays it. If the video stream is interrupted for any reason, I would like to insert a static image into the stream being sent to the remote process.
I have a PNG that is the same resolution as the camera. I thought I could use ffmpeg to encode the PNG to H.264 to get an IFrame that I could insert into the stream but I have not had any success. Using ffmpeg I created an MP4 with H.264 encoding from the PNG image and then extracted what I believed was the H.264 data from the MP4 but when I try to decode it ffmpeg returns an error.
Anyone have any ideas on how I could accomplish this ?
